How does a resident submit a complaint or concern through the SDL Portal?
- Go to sdlportal.com and select your municipality.
- Click "Report an Issue" (or go to Request > the appropriate complaint type).
- You may be prompted to re-enter your password — this is expected, not an error.
- Select the issue type from the dropdown — use "Filter by Department" to narrow the list.
- Enter details — be specific about size, severity, location, and how long the issue has existed.
- Add a location — four options: search by property address, drop a pin for an exact location, use device location (only shown if the town has enabled it and location services are on), or submit with no location.
- Attach files (optional) — only appears if the town has enabled attachments for that complaint type.
- Review and click Submit Request — a confirmation email is sent.
Tracking status: Account > My Activity > Requests.
Common issues
| Problem | Solution |
| "Use my location" not showing | Enable device location services, and confirm the town has activated the feature |
| Attachment option missing | Town hasn't enabled it for this complaint type — expected |
| Confirmation email not received | Check spam; Office 365 mailboxes have a known SendGrid delivery limitation |
Most complaint types require an SDL Portal account, though some towns allow anonymous submission. Account creation is free at sdlportal.com.
